My go to mic for bass guitar is a beta 52 because I like how it mixes with a DI. I also like certain condensers on bass like the BLUE 8-ball or the KSM32 and 27.

I've never tried a figure 8 mic on bass. Usually when I am micing a bass cab I am also micing guitar cabs that are right next to it so bleed is an issue and I would be reluctant to try in this situation.
